Everything Looks Better in Black and White

The Us and Them paradigm has become the norm.

Is anyone else wondering why it seems lately that the world is boiling down to dichotomies, black and white, my way or the highway?

It seems to me that as long as we human beings continue to see through the filter of Us and Them it becomes all the more important to pick sides and then fight for whatever that side is supposed to stand for.  Or else what?  What might happen if the E word got employed just a bit more?

Empathy. Seeing things from another’s perspective.  Caring about the affect on others.  Examining nuances.  Being willing to bend a bit to be more inclusive. Not thinking of compromise as weakness, but as a way of building a bridge. I believe if you live long enough you get to reexamine all the truths by which you might once have defined yourself.  “Don’t trust anyone over 30” seemed reasonable once – until everyone was over 30 and it seemed ridiculous.  In the current atmosphere of political vilification our leaders are demonstrating schoolyard behavior one would hope they could have outgrown by now.  Even as they hopefully come to some kind of 11th hour conclusion to keep us afloat they angrily point out the evils of the Others.  The truth is, if you can think of Others as truly different than yourself you can do anything to them.  That truth has surfaced time and time again in history.  We need to come together, not just in times of tragedy, but as human beings who share this planet, and care more for each other. What if there is no US, no THEM, no black, no white?  Then what?
